Quick answer
A crack is not serious or harmless based on one visual feature alone. Location, direction, width, change over time, moisture and related movement signs provide a more useful screening picture.

Signals that increase concern
Escalation becomes more reasonable when several signs appear together, the condition is worsening, there is active water or damage, or normal operation/use is affected. A stable isolated symptom usually calls for a different next step than a progressing pattern.
